WARNER ROBINS – Tucked away in a small space inside a convenience store in the Bonaire community of Warner Robins is a new takeaway spot that its fans are raving about on social media.

Taste Good Restaurant serves up smash burgers and wings as well as gumbo and specialty dishes made with salmon, shrimp, chicken or steak, vegetables and homemade sauces.

The new spot at the Hwy 96 Stop N Shop and Shell gas station at 198 Old Perry Road offers breakfast, too.

“Believe it or not, I actually found it from a review on TikTok, that’s how I found out about it, and a couple of days later, I was like, ‘Well, I’ll go and give it a try,’ “ said Anthony Dunn of Kathleen, who stopped in recently to pick up some wings.

“And they were actually reviewing the smash burger that I actually ended up getting when I was here last week. It was fantastic.”

Felicia Thomas of Warner Robins first heard about Taste Good Restaurant on Facebook. She’d also heard a couple of good reviews.

“I just wanted to see for myself,” said Thomas, who first tried the “very juicy, tender” smash burger and was back recently for a second visit.

This time, she ordered salmon over rice with spinach, mushrooms and tomatoes with garlic parmesan and miso sauces drizzled on top.

“10 out of 10,” Thomas said of both the smash burger and the salmon dish when contacted again later by telephone. She liked the salmon so much that she posted a photo on Facebook that went viral.

“The service was amazing,” she said. “I like how they cook everything to order so it’s fresh and just the taste and quality. Everything about it was splendid.”

Taste Good Restaurant is owned by DaLionel Lightning, who operates the spot with his girlfriend and self-taught chef Zaakiyah Abdullah; his mom, Rosie Lightning, who works there part-time; and employee Rena Jonas.

DaLionel Lightning and Abdullah have been together for about three years, and Abdullah was the one that got him interested in opening a restaurant. Lightning also owns Lightning Auto Sales and Lightning Auto Detail at 1209 South Houston Lake Road in Warner Robins.

“I have a big background of doing a lot of different things, but cooking is one of my biggest passions,” said Abdullah, who previously worked as a cook at the Center for Disease Control in Atlanta. “It’s one of my dreams.

“So, when he decided to open this, it was like, ‘Let’s go for it,’ because like people say, anybody can cook, but a dream is just a dream unless you bring it to life.”

Abdullah is behind the recipes for all the specialty dishes she likes to call “exquisites.”

For those dishes, customers first choose a base from yellow rice, penne pasta or a baked potato, next a protein from chicken, salmon, shrimp or steak, and then vegetables, including broccoli, mushrooms, spinach, onions, peppers and tomatoes.

For the final touch, customers choose among sauces that are drizzled on top, including Cajun (spicy), garlic parmesan, rasta (spicy), four-cheese alfredo, yum yum and miso (sweet).

“I like to call them my little secret weapon recipes when it comes to my cream sauces,” Abdullah said. “It’s just not like your regular alfredo. It’s infused with different herbs.

“All my sauces are infused with different herbs … I try to make it with love and put something in it that’s good, or I like to say exquisite. So it’s like exquisite cream sauces that I made from scratch.”

Abdullah first got interested in cooking because of her mom.

“I always wanted to learn how to cook like my mom,” she said. “I have inspiration from friends and family, of course; just cooking for people.”

As for the smash burgers and wings, Lightning came up with those.

“Our burgers are homemade with 100% beef,” Abdullah interjected. “So I feel like that’s pretty gourmet.

“You can do smash burgers inside like a regular burger. You can put mushrooms on it. You can put bacon on it. You can jazz it up to whatever you like.”

The menu also includes gumbo made with chicken and beef sausage, and salads with a choice of meat and add-ons such as tomatoes, cucumbers, boiled eggs, shredded cheese and such. Customers also may add extra meats to the dishes, such as shrimp to the gumbo, if they’d like.

For breakfast, the restaurant offers waffle sandwiches, buttermilk biscuit sandwiches, omelets, a classic breakfast with choice of meat, two eggs, hash browns or grits, and biscuit or toast. Shrimp and grits also are available.

With the success of the restaurant in just a short time since opening May 16, Lightning expects to move to a new location in a couple of months that will offer dine-in and focus on their speciality menu.

He also expects to keep the current takeout spot open but with a limited menu.

“We’re gonna do just like quick stuff like burgers and fries. But if you want more of our exquisites, you’ll have to come over to the sit-down restaurant,” he said.

If all goes according to plan, the new dine-in location will be in a suite in a nearby strip shopping center anchored by E-Z Buy convenience store and Sunoco at 200 Ga. 96 that’s kitty-corner to the current location.

The current location off Old Perry Road has one table with several chairs for customers to wait for their food that’s made-to-order. A pavilion with three picnic tables also is available for customers to eat outside.

Customers may order at the counter, call ahead or order delivery through DoorDash.

Hours are 6 a.m. to 7 p.m. Monday through Thursday, 6 a.m. to 8 p.m. Friday, 10:30 a.m. to 8 p.m. Saturday, and 10:30 a.m. to 5 p.m. Sunday. The number is 478-318-8492.
